Red Lentils

Red lentils are small reddish brown seed coat with a red yellow cotyledon. The two classes of red lentils grown in Canada are:

Robin - smallest size, football shaped seeds primarily consumed in Bangladesh.  These seeds are usually dehusked (outer skin removed) to promote quicker cooking and a more attractive appearance.

Crimson - slightly larger and flatter shaped seeds that are dehusked and split before consumption. Crimson are the largest market and are consumed throughout the Middle East, India, and Pakistan as a source of non meat protein.
